Abstract: The Programmable Interface Controller with Autonomous Robotic Spraying Operation (PICARSO) system is a cable-driven painting system, with image processing capabilities. It is used as a robotic graffiti artist, with the capacity to paint both raster and vector images of any size. This paper describes the design of the system, its mechanical and electrical components, the kinematics of the cable-driven system, its imaging processing capabilities as well as results illustrating its performance.
